Abstract:
Global warming is an unanimously accepted phenomenon by the international scientific community, being already highlighted by the analysis of observational data over long periods of time, with an increase in temperature of over 1 °C. Climate change in Romania is part of the global context, taking into account the regional conditions, with an increasing trend of arid summer. While the link between high temperatures, climate change and rainfall has been modeled in detail, the situation is not the same for plant water accessibility. The period of time between 1898 and the present, corresponding to the annual records of precipitation and evapotranspiration, overlapped with important political and administrative changes in the studied area, and with extensive hydro-amelioration works. The aim of the paper is to statistically follow the evolution over time of precipitation, namely of evapotranspiration measured in Western Romania, which would allow the expression of conclusions regarding the improvement directions of the water regime. In order to follow the evolution in time of these data, the interval of 1898–2019 was divided into three periods: 1898–1950, 1951–1989 and 1990–2019, respectively. The increase in temperature, especially during the vegetation period and the large number of years in which evapotranspiration quantitatively exceeds the precipitation, indicating the need for effective measures to regulate the water balance.
